uptimenow
4,669 Views

Forgot to add, if you are using a Nagios plugin such as check_netapp_ontap.pl it will look specifically for this info:

 

if (defined($nahDisk->child_get("disk-raid-info")->child_get("disk-aggregate-info"))) {
$hshDiskInfo{$strDiskName}{'scrubbing'} = $nahDisk->child_get("disk-raid-info")->child_get("disk-aggregate-info")->child_get_string("is-media-scrubbing");

 

Because it is looking specifically under disk-aggregate-info, those disks will pop up as scrubbing when for instance spare disks where <is-media-scrubbing> is sitting under <disk-spare-info> and this Nagios plugin doesn't check this.

Very interesting discussions. It's not my area of expertise but I read something interesting and thought of sharing.


Could it be that  the API <is-media-scrubbing> is refering to 'Media scrubbing' (continous background process). If so, then it will come back 'true'. Isn't it.


Media scrubbing = is a "continuous background process". Therefore, you might observe disk LEDs blinking on an apparently idle storage system. You might also observe some CPU activity even when no user workload is present.

 

RAID-level scrub operation = is at the RAID-level (scheduled), this type of scrub finds and corrects parity and checksum errors as well as media errors.


This is an old NetApp KB (What does raid.media_scrub.enable option do) marked for 7-mode:
https://kb.netapp.com/app/answers/answer_view/a_id/1004900

 

However it menions the registry which is still inherited in cDOT/ONTAP, an example below:

It says : "This option enables continuous media scrubbing on the NetApp filer."

 

On my FAS8200/FAS8020/AFF300 | ONTAP 9.1 , it is ON
1) raid.media_scrub.enable on = continuous media scrubbing disk@Aggr 
2) raid.scrub.enable on = This option specifies the weekly schedule @RAID

 

These registry option are only visible from diag mode :

::>set diag
::>options raid*

 

I don't have FAS8040, but could it be that on those systems it was turned off at filer level.
